The doctoral student of the Lehman – Haupt program, Eka Gurgenashvili participated in the international scientific conference held on August 19-23, 2019, in Vienna, Austria. The conference, Stars and their variability, observed from space (https://starsandspace.univie.ac.at/home/) was one of the biggest conference in Europe with more than 220 participants from all over the world and included several different topics. 

The main topics were the structures of the stars, magnetic field, stellar evolution, interaction with their environment and etc. The senior scientists discussed about the open issues and the most recent achievements in space observation and theory. 

Eka Gurgenashvili presented her scientific poster in the session “Variability Other Than Pulsation”. The topic was “Rieger-type periodicity in the activity of the Sun-like stars”, where she reported her recent results about the stellar and solar activity and the periodicities found there. 

She met with her supervisor, Prof. Teimuraz Zaqarashvili and other colleges, who also participated in the conference.
